				 LlamaServer down for 48 hours 
 Everyone using the LlamaServer should have got an e-mail anyway, but...
 While I transfer the LlamaServer to a new and hopefully permanent home, it'll be down for the next 48 hours. Sorry about the inconvenience. Once it's back up it should hopefully be super-reliable.
